NetBackup™ for VMware Administrator's Guide

Storage Destination panel

The Storage Destination wizard panel shows the virtual disks to restore. They are either the disks you selected or the disks on which the file systems you selected for restore reside.

Settings for all virtual disks region

To change the values that apply to all of the virtual disks, use the fields in the Settings for all virtual disks region of the wizard panel, as follows:

  • Restored virtual disks provisioning

    The default disk provisioning for all of the disks to be restored: Thin, Thick Lazy Zeroed, or Thick Eager Zeroed.

  • Datastore

    The name of the Datastore or the datastore cluster that is the destination for the restore.

    Click Browse to select a different datastore or datastore cluster.

  • Overwrite all virtual disks

    Whether to overwrite the existing virtual disk or disks on the target VM. If Yes, overwrite the original virtual disk and retain the disk UUID. If No, restore the virtual disk to the target VM as a new disk; VMware assigns a new UUID to the disk.

Original Virtual Disk list

To override the global settings, change the values for individual virtual disks in the Original Virtual Disk list.
